UPVC window lock repairs

uPVC windows are a popular choice for new homes as well as renovations. These windows have many advantages including durability as well as ease of maintenance and energy efficiency. These windows are BPA and phthalate free which makes them safe for children to use. They are also rustproof and don't require varnishing or painting. They will not get warped, rot or leak, and are easy to clean. Despite their durability and ease of maintenance, uPVC can sometimes develop problems that need professional attention. These problems may include a draughty window or a damaged handle or a damaged lock.

In many cases, uPVC door and window locks become damaged over time as a result of wear and tear or accidental damage. This can make them less effective and more vulnerable to burglaries. It is therefore essential to fix the parts as quickly as you can. Fortunately, you can accomplish this by contacting a local double-glazing specialist. This type of specialist has been trained to complete a broad range of repairs and upgrades for uPVC doors and windows. They can also recommend other security products, such as letterbox guards and door viewers.

A gap between the frame of the sash and the frame could be the reason behind your uPVC windows not closing properly. This could cause draughts, however it could also cause dampness and water damage. You can check by putting some paper between the sash frame and the sash, to see whether the sash is closed.

To solve this issue, you'll need to remove the seal around the frame and sash. You will then need to remove the locking mechanism from its location within the frame. To access the gearbox you will require a flat torch or screwdriver. After removing the gearbox you will need to replace with a new one that is the same size and type.
